Output f01f6e41436424e2e8014e6f1a8c58a2724cbe0deb30e84965c155f18230d35a:63

value
17733928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67378d13955f82e4229cc6567b549b6162f3141c OP_EQUAL
address
3B6n54NiZbkZNCfmUfRoWH3EiUHpac7hYJ
transaction
f01f6e41436424e2e8014e6f1a8c58a2724cbe0deb30e84965c155f18230d35a
confirmations
386509
spent
true